如何利用VSCode的调试工具优化网页性能?

在现代Web开发中,网页性能优化是确保用户获得流畅、快速体验的关键。Visual Studio Code(简称VSCode)作为一个强大且灵活的代码编辑器,提供了丰富的调试工具,帮助开发者识别和解决性能瓶颈。本文将探讨如何使用VSCode的调试工具来优化网页性能。

如何利用VSCode的调试工具优化网页性能?

安装必要的扩展

为了充分利用VSCode的调试功能,建议安装一些常用的扩展。例如,“Debugger for Chrome”或“Debugger for Edge”扩展允许你在浏览器中运行和调试JavaScript代码。这些扩展通过连接到Chrome或Edge浏览器,使你能够在VSCode中设置断点、查看变量值、执行单步调试等操作。还可以考虑安装其他与性能分析相关的扩展,如Lighthouse或Performance Analyzer,以更深入地了解页面加载时间和资源使用情况。

配置调试环境

安装好所需的扩展后,下一步是配置调试环境。你需要创建一个launch.json文件,在其中定义启动配置。对于基于Node.js的应用程序,可以配置Node.js调试器;而对于前端项目,则应选择适当的浏览器调试器。配置完成后,你可以通过点击左侧边栏中的“Run and Debug”图标来启动调试会话。确保你的开发服务器已经启动,并且可以在本地访问。

使用断点进行逐步调试

一旦进入了调试模式,就可以开始利用断点来逐步检查代码执行过程了。在VSCode中,只需双击行号旁边的空白区域即可插入断点。当程序运行到该行时会自动暂停,此时你可以检查当前状态下的所有变量及其值,从而更容易发现潜在问题。如果遇到复杂逻辑或循环结构,还可以结合条件断点(Conditional Breakpoints),只有满足特定条件时才会触发中断。

分析性能热点

除了传统的断点调试外,VSCode还支持对性能热点进行分析。借助内置的CPU Profiler工具,你可以记录一段时间内的函数调用情况,并生成详细的性能报告。这有助于识别哪些部分消耗了过多时间,进而采取措施加以改进。例如,减少不必要的DOM操作、优化算法效率或者异步加载非关键资源等。

监测网络请求

网页性能不仅仅取决于客户端代码的表现,网络请求的速度同样重要。VSCode的调试工具能够帮助你监控每个HTTP请求的状态和耗时。通过Network面板,你可以清晰地看到请求的时间分布图,包括DNS查询、建立连接、发送数据以及接收响应等多个阶段的具体用时。对于那些明显过慢的请求,尝试优化API接口设计、启用缓存机制或是压缩传输内容。

通过合理运用VSCode提供的调试工具,我们可以有效地提升网页的整体性能。从基础的断点调试到高级的性能分析,每一步都为找出并修复性能瓶颈提供了强有力的支持。实际应用中还需要结合具体场景和个人经验不断探索最佳实践。希望这篇文章能为你提供有价值的参考,助力打造更加高效的Web应用程序。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/136452.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月21日 上午8:12
下一篇 2025年1月21日 上午8:12

相关推荐

  • 如何使用Dreamweaver快速创建响应式网站?

    在当今数字化时代,拥有一个响应式网站对于吸引和留住访客至关重要。Adobe Dreamweaver 是一款功能强大的网页设计工具,它可以帮助您快速创建美观且适应各种设备的响应式网站。 1. 安装并熟悉Dreamweaver环境 确保您的计算机上已经安装了最新版本的 Adobe Dreamweaver。启动软件后,花一些时间浏览界面,了解其布局和主要功能。熟悉…

    2025年1月21日
    700
  • 建站宝盒营销班分享:如何分析网站数据并据此调整策略?

    在当今数字化营销时代,数据是推动业务增长的关键因素。企业需要了解自身网站的流量、用户行为等信息来制定更有效的数字营销策略。建站宝盒营销班分享了关于如何利用数据分析优化网站性能以及提高转化率的方法。 一、设定目标 在开始进行数据分析之前,必须明确你的业务目标是什么。这可能包括增加销售额、提升品牌知名度或吸引更多潜在客户访问网站。确定具体的目标有助于选择合适的数…

    2025年1月23日
    600
  • VPS建站时,如何备份和恢复数据以防止数据丢失?

    在VPS(虚拟专用服务器)上建立网站时,确保数据的安全性和完整性至关重要。尽管VPS提供了相对独立的环境和更高的控制权,但仍然存在硬件故障、软件错误或人为失误导致的数据丢失风险。定期备份并掌握有效的恢复方法是每个站长必须考虑的关键问题。 选择合适的备份策略 为了最大限度地保护您的网站免受潜在的数据丢失威胁,您需要制定一个全面且高效的备份计划。以下是一些常见的…

    2025年1月19日
    700
  • 在不限建站数空间中,怎样确保各个站点的数据安全与隐私保护?

    如今,随着互联网技术的发展,企业对网站的建设需求日益增加。许多企业或个人选择使用不限建站数量的空间来创建多个站点,以满足业务拓展的需求。在享受便捷的如何保障各个站点的数据安全和用户隐私成为了一个重要的问题。本文将从以下几个方面探讨如何在不限建站数空间中确保各站点的数据安全与隐私保护。 1. 强化身份认证机制 为防止未经授权的访问,应该强化身份认证机制。例如采…

    2025年1月21日
    800
  • IIS服务器的安全防护:防止常见攻击的有效措施

    IIS(Internet Information Services)服务器作为微软的Web服务器软件,被广泛应用于企业级Web应用程序的部署中。随着互联网的发展,网络攻击日益频繁且复杂多变,对IIS服务器的安全性提出了更高的要求。为了保障IIS服务器的安全,防止常见攻击的有效措施显得尤为重要。 一、防止SQL注入攻击 SQL注入攻击是通过将恶意SQL语句插入…

    2025年1月19日
    700

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部